Beware of Misleading Reviews and Services

Please take a moment to consider this before trusting the overly positive reviews. I enrolled in a savings program that was supposed to help improve my credit score, which had suffered due to past financial abuse during a serious health crisis. After a year, my credit score showed no improvement despite consistent payments to other creditors. I paid a total of $1,830, yet ended up with only $750 saved. I was promised a loan at a favorable interest rate upon completion of the program, but was instead offered a $1,500 loan, which was far less than I needed. Previously, I had been directed to a lender for a larger amount, for which I'm still paying exorbitant interest rates. To get the $1,500 loan, they wanted to hold my remaining $750 as collateral, with an 18-month term and biweekly payments adding up to an outrageous total of $3,120. This translates to over 100% additional interest disguised as fees and unnecessary insurance premiums. I was informed that the APR on the loan was 31.99%, which is shocking. As a former financial planner, I recognize the predatory nature of this organization, which exploits those in need. They prey on vulnerable individuals, draining their financial resources under the guise of assistance. I strongly advise against trusting this service.
